The idea of your filter, is based on the Zeiss Softar for Hasselblad.
The Softar mostly softened skin but not textures..

This will yield an image with a sharp in focus center and a soft focus periphery.
Reminds me of a crude Zeiss softar filter with an unfiltered center.

Yep. We used to put vaseline on a UV filter to make a soft-focus filter for portrait photography. One with little dots like this would do a nice job softening, plus the pink hue of the stuff applied would warm up the image just slightly. Worth keeping for when you want to do softened beauty shots but don't feel like messing with Photoshop too much. Especially in the days before digital manipulation, there used to be a lot of very creative DIY in photography.
